heathern
In Appalachian and Southern speech, "heathern" is a colorful variant of "heathen." It’s often used to scold rowdy kids or call someone uncivilized or wild.

★ "Heathern" usually isn’t meant literally. It’s a mountain way of fussing at kids, friends, or kinfolk for acting wild or unrefined. ★
